diff options
Diffstat (limited to 'recipes/application-registry')
7 files changed, 64 insertions, 0 deletions
diff --git a/recipes/application-registry/application-registry-0.1/abiword.applications b/recipes/application-registry/application-registry-0.1/abiword.applications new file mode 100644 index 0000000000..28a6e9cf2b --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/abiword.applications @@ -0,0 +1,7 @@ +abiword + command=AbiWord-2.0 + name=AbiWord + can_open_multiple_files=true + expects_uris=false + requires_terminal=false + mime_types=text/*,text/abiword,application/x-abiword,application/rtf,application/msword diff --git a/recipes/application-registry/application-registry-0.1/firefox.applications b/recipes/application-registry/application-registry-0.1/firefox.applications new file mode 100644 index 0000000000..d0fd3ccc73 --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/firefox.applications @@ -0,0 +1,8 @@ +firefox + command=firefox + name=Firefox Browser + can_open_multiple_files=true + expects_uris=true + requires_terminal=false + supported_uri_schemes=file,http,ftp,telnet,gopher + mime_types=text/html,x-directory/webdav,x-directory/webdav-prefer-directory,image/gif,image/jpeg,text/xml diff --git a/recipes/application-registry/application-registry-0.1/gnumeric.applications b/recipes/application-registry/application-registry-0.1/gnumeric.applications new file mode 100644 index 0000000000..9a878047ff --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/gnumeric.applications @@ -0,0 +1,7 @@ +gnumeric + command=gnumeric + name=Gnumeric + can_open_multiple_files=true + expects_uris=false + requires_terminal=false + mime_types=application/x-gnumeric,application/x-applix-spreadsheet,application/vnd.ms-excel,application/vnd.lotus-1-2-3,application/x-oleo,application/x-xbase,text/spreadsheet,text/x-comma-separated-values,text/tab-separated-values diff --git a/recipes/application-registry/application-registry-0.1/gpe-calendar.applications b/recipes/application-registry/application-registry-0.1/gpe-calendar.applications new file mode 100644 index 0000000000..9e0c4eb175 --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/gpe-calendar.applications @@ -0,0 +1,7 @@ +gpe-calendar + requires_terminal=false + expects_uris=false + command=gpe-calendar -i + can_open_multiple_files=false + name=Calendar + mime_types=text/x-vcalendar diff --git a/recipes/application-registry/application-registry-0.1/gpe-contacts.applications b/recipes/application-registry/application-registry-0.1/gpe-contacts.applications new file mode 100644 index 0000000000..b68ee9af20 --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/gpe-contacts.applications @@ -0,0 +1,7 @@ +gpe-contacts + requires_terminal=false + expects_uris=false + command=gpe-contacts -i + can_open_multiple_files=false + name=Contacts + mime_types=text/vcard diff --git a/recipes/application-registry/application-registry-0.1/ipkg.applications b/recipes/application-registry/application-registry-0.1/ipkg.applications new file mode 100644 index 0000000000..11cb5fcbce --- /dev/null +++ b/recipes/application-registry/application-registry-0.1/ipkg.applications @@ -0,0 +1,7 @@ +ipkg + command=ipkg install + name=Install Package (ipkg) + can_open_multiple_files=true + expects_uris=false + requires_terminal=true + mime_types=application/x-ipk diff --git a/recipes/application-registry/application-registry_0.1.bb b/recipes/application-registry/application-registry_0.1.bb new file mode 100644 index 0000000000..1ebfbdd907 --- /dev/null +++ b/recipes/application-registry/application-registry_0.1.bb @@ -0,0 +1,21 @@ +PR = "r3" + +DESCRIPTION = "additional application registry files" +DEPENDS = "shared-mime-info" +RDEPENDS = "shared-mime-info" +SECTION = "gpe" +PRIORITY = "optional" +LICENSE = "MIT" +SRC_URI = "file://abiword.applications \ + file://firefox.applications \ + file://gnumeric.applications \ + file://gpe-calendar.applications \ + file://gpe-contacts.applications \ + file://ipkg.applications" + + +do_install_append () { + mkdir -p ${D}${datadir}/application-registry + install -m 0644 ${WORKDIR}/*.applications ${D}${datadir}/application-registry/ +} + |